When should I hire a spine injury lawyer?
It's recommended to employ a lawyer as soon as possible after the injury. Early legal support assists collect proof and constructs a strong case.
2. What is the statute of restrictions for spine injury claims?
The statute of limitations differs by state however typically falls between one to 3 years from the date of injury. Consult a lawyer for specifics in your jurisdiction.
3. How do spinal cord injury lawyers charge for their services?
Lots of spine injury legal representatives work on a contingency charge basis, implying they only receive payment if you win your case. Their costs typically vary from 25% to 40% of the settlement.
